How they compare
Ecuador currently reports 475,862 current US$ per square kilometre against 465,894 current US$ per square kilometre in Pakistan, a difference of 9,968 current US$ per square kilometre.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 62 shared years of data; in 1962 it was Ecuador ahead.
Ecuador ranks 113th and Pakistan ranks 115th of 205 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Ecuador averaged higher in 5 and Pakistan in 2.

About this data
GNI, Atlas method (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
